The ICT Internal Logistics Specialist (Level 92) serves as the technical and functional design authority for internal logistics and material flow systems supporting Assembly and Powertrain manufacturing operations across North American plants. This role is accountable for end ‑to ‑end system ownership, ensuring operational stability, data integrity, and compliance for material execution processes spanning inbound sequencing, internal material movements, line ‑side delivery, consumption confirmation, and shipment readiness.
The role leads complex, cross ‑plant initiatives supporting new program launches, plant re ‑layouts, automation deployments, and production readiness, while driving standardization, risk mitigation, and continuous improvement of internal logistics solutions. Acting as the primary interface between ICT, Plant Operations, Logistics, Manufacturing Engineering, Central Engineering, and strategic suppliers, the specialist ensures solutions align with manufacturing and logistics standards, cybersecurity policies, and business priorities, while delivering measurable value to plant operations.
